Nazi Commander Suspected of Killing Jews Arrested in Austria

February 19, 1963
See Original Daily Bulletin From This Date

Police here announced today the arrest of Julius Garbler, former commander of the Nazi secret police in the Polish village of Debica. He was arrested on suspicion of participation in the mass killing of Polish Jews during the wartime occupation.
